Robert "Bob" C. DeLong's Obituary
DELONG, Robert “Bob” Charles, age 86, of Bellbrook, passed away Saturday, February 22, 2025, surrounded by family at home.
Bob was born September 30, 1938, in Peoria, Illinois, to the late Clifford Charles and Beatrice (Snell) DeLong. Bob attended Woodruff High School in Peoria, where he graduated in 1957. Following graduation, he enrolled at Bradley University, where he earned a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ering and subsequently served proudly in the United States Army.
Bob began his career in 1967 at Technology/Scientific Services Inc., providing scientific services and support to the aerospace and defense industries. Bob was promoted to the position of Chief Engineer in 1975, served as General Manager, and was subsequently promoted to President of the Technology/ Scientific Services Inc. division of Krug International.
In 1975, Bob looked up an old acquaintance, asked her to dinner, and what followed was a relationship lasting nearly 50 years. It was the making of a true love story. Bob and Donna were married on August 11, 1976.
Bob was a fantastic husband, father, grandfather, and great-grandfather. He was also a good friend and mentor and was looked up to by many. He enjoyed spending time with his grandson, Corbyn, as he pursued the status of Eagle Scout in Boy Scout Troop 375. He was loved and respected by all who knew him.
He enjoyed fishing, photography, and woodworking. He enjoyed spending time at his property on Elk Lake in Owenton, Kentucky, BA weekends with Team Suter in Centreville, Michigan, and shooting his M1 Garand.
Bob was preceded in death by his parents, Clifford and Beatrice DeLong; one sister, Betty; one brother, Donald; his grandson, Cody Lester; one brother-in-law, Bill Suter; his sister-in-law and good friend, Barb and Ken McDaniel; and dear friends, Harry and Carol Grieselhuber.
Bob is survived by his wife of 48 years, Donna; his children, Teri (Bobby) Block, Tamra Temple, Kevin Temple, Laura (Todd) Hartline, and Robyn DeLong; his grandchildren, Jessica (Jim) Hayden, Norah Awad, Saleh Awad, Taylor (Eli) Exum, Griffin Hartline, Alec Hartline, Corbyn DeLong, Chloe Lester, and Cayne DeLong; one great-granddaughter, Eileen Exum; one sister-in-law, Barb Suter; many nieces, nephews, and cousins; good friends, Gary Burnett and Maggie Wiseman, Larry and Doris Tackett, and many, many more.
